London dentists and the effective treatment of dental pain

Dental pain can be very unsettling, not just because it can be very severe but because it can make you feel so helpless. If you are suffering from a really bad toothache, there is little you can do yourself to make the pain any better. This is why it is so important to see a dentist if you are suffering any kind of dental pain. Even if it is relatively mild, it is always a good idea to see a dentist as soon as possible as dental pain often gets worse over time as the problem is exacerbated.
There are many kinds of dental pain caused by many different things. Pain can range from dull, constant throbbing to sharp and severe twinges. This very much depends on what is wrong with your teeth. There are a few things that you can do to make the stress of the pain easier. Over the counter pain killers will help to numb the pain somewhat, but be sure never to pot the tablets up against the area of pain in the mouth as this can cause damage to the soft tissue.
Ice applied to the outside of the cheek around the area of the pain will also help to numb it, although this is more of a short-term relief. The only real solution to dental pain is to see your London dentist as soon as possible. They will be able to get to the root of the problem and carry out any necessary treatment. If your pain is a dental emergency and out of office hours, an answering service on your dentists phone number should be able to give you details of the emergency on-call dentist. If the pain is severe, never put off seeing the dentist, even if the pain appears to be going away as this could indicate the dental nerve is under threat.
